I often use log:tail to follow the logs. After I'm done I type Ctrl+C. The 
problem with this is that there seems to be an invisible character (possible 
Ctrl+C) left in the input buffer. If I type a command directly after using 
log:tail, I get a CommandNotFoundException.

The simple work around is to press backspace each time after using log:tail, 
but this is simple to forget.
